Link Shortening Platforms: A Complete Guide
In the modern internet-driven era, distributing URLs has become a common practice for businesses, marketers, and individuals alike. But, lengthy and messy URLs tend to look unattractive when shared on social media. This is where link shortener services become extremely useful.
A web address shortener is a tool that transforms a complex link into a brief and readable format. The new short address sends visitors to the same target without any changes.

Disadvantages of URL Shortener Services
Despite all their strengths, short link services do come with some limitations that marketers must understand.
- Invisible target: Users cannot see the destination URL prior to visiting
- Trust concerns: Some users hesitate to click unfamiliar compact links out of suspicion
- Dependence on service providers: If the shortening service shuts down or changes, the redirects may fail entirely
- URL timeout: Certain platforms impose usage restrictions on generated short addresses
- Security risks: These tools can be exploited for phishing attacks

Choosing the Most Suitable Link Shortener
Before picking a short link tool, look at these key aspects:
- Custom domain support: Look for services that let you use your brand name
- Click tracking panel: Make sure the platform offers in-depth tracking
- Redirect stability: Choose a service that guarantees link permanence
- Pricing and plans: Review pricing tiers before committing
- Spam protection: Prefer platforms that include spam filters for user safety
